What Defines Continuous Glucose Monitor Factory Quality Control Standards?
Continuous glucose monitor (CGM) devices require exacting manufacturing processes to deliver consistent, real-time glucose readings. Quality control standards in CGM factories encompass all stages from raw material sourcing, production, assembly, firmware integration, to final testing. These standards ensure the devices conform to regulatory, functional, and safety requirements mandated by global health authorities.

Key Regulatory Compliance in CGM Manufacturing
Factories specializing in continuous glucose monitors must comply with international certifications such as CE marking and RoHS directives. These certifications verify that devices meet European Union safety, health, and environmental protection requirements. Additionally, adherence to ISO 13485 is fundamental for medical device quality management systems, underscoring a factory’s commitment to quality and risk management.

Critical Quality Control Processes in a Continuous Glucose Monitor Factory
To maintain high standards, CGM factories implement multi-layered quality control protocols. These typically include incoming material inspection, in-process monitoring, and final device validation. Each step is meticulously documented and traceable to ensure full transparency and accountability.
Incoming Material Inspection
The quality control process begins with rigorous testing of components such as sensors, chips, batteries, and casings. Only materials that pass these inspections move forward in the manufacturing pipeline. This proactive approach prevents defects from propagating through the assembly line.
In-Process Monitoring and Assembly
During assembly, continuous glucose monitor factory quality control standards require real-time monitoring of production parameters. Automated optical inspection (AOI) and functional testing are integrated to detect anomalies early. This stage also includes firmware installation and verification tailored to client specifications.
Final Device Testing and Calibration
Before packaging, each CGM unit undergoes comprehensive testing to validate sensor accuracy, battery performance, wireless connectivity, and user interface functionality. Calibration against standardized glucose levels is critical for device reliability.

Firmware and Software Validation
Since CGM performance heavily depends on embedded software, thorough validation cycles are mandatory. This includes security testing, bug fixing, and compatibility checks with companion mobile applications. Quality control here guarantees seamless user experience and data accuracy.

Technological Innovations Enhancing Quality Control in CGM Manufacturing
Leading continuous glucose monitor factories leverage Industry 4.0 technologies such as IoT-enabled monitoring, AI-driven defect detection, and automated data logging. These innovations increase accuracy, reduce human errors, and provide real-time quality analytics for continuous improvement.
Traceability and Documentation
Maintaining detailed traceability of every component and process step is mandatory. This documentation facilitates compliance audits and post-market surveillance, reinforcing accountability in the manufacturing cycle.
